I pay $14 monthly at togglebox.com for the FREE PIZZA server, it's a Debian Linux running on 2 CPUs, 20GB disk, 1GB RAM and 2 TB monthly bandwidth.
People tell me that the server is fast and it's not laggy.

I pay $5 a month for my server. Above 10 players you can notice lag, with about 20 the lag becomes so strong that it's not fun to play any more.
That is (according to the hoster) 512 MB, 1 CPU, 20 GB SSD, 1000 GB Transfer.
